- #ifdef RPC_HDR
- %/*
- % * The following structures are used by version 2 of the rusersd protocol.
- % * They were not developed with rpcgen, so they do not appear as RPCL.
- % */
- %
- %#define RUSERSVERS_ORIG 1 /* original version */
- %#define RUSERSVERS_IDLE 2
- %#define MAXUSERS 100
- %
- %/*
- % * This is the structure used in version 2 of the rusersd RPC service.
- % * It corresponds to the utmp structure for BSD sytems.
- % */
- %struct ru_utmp {
- % char ut_line[8]; /* tty name */
- % char ut_name[8]; /* user id */
- % char ut_host[16]; /* host name, if remote */
- % long ut_time; /* time on */
- %};
- %typedef struct ru_utmp rutmp;
- %
- %struct utmparr {
- % struct utmp **uta_arr;
- % int uta_cnt;
- %};
- %typedef struct utmparr utmparr;
- %int xdr_utmparr();
- %
- %struct utmpidle {
- % struct ru_utmp ui_utmp;
- % unsigned ui_idle;
- %};
- %
- %struct utmpidlearr {
- % struct utmpidle **uia_arr;
- % int uia_cnt;
- %};
- %typedef struct utmpidlearr utmpidlearr;
- %int xdr_utmpidlearr();
- %
- %#define RUSERSVERS_1 ((u_long)1)
- %#define RUSERSVERS_2 ((u_long)2)
- %#ifndef RUSERSPROG
- %#define RUSERSPROG ((u_long)100002)
- %#endif
- %#ifndef RUSERSPROC_NUM
- %#define RUSERSPROC_NUM ((u_long)1)
- %#endif
- %#ifndef RUSERSPROC_NAMES
- %#define RUSERSPROC_NAMES ((u_long)2)
- %#endif
- %#ifndef RUSERSPROC_ALLNAMES
- %#define RUSERSPROC_ALLNAMES ((u_long)3)
- %#endif
- %
- #endif /* RPC_HDR */

- #ifdef RPC_XDR
- %bool_t
- %xdr_utmp(xdrs, objp)
- % XDR *xdrs;
- % struct ru_utmp *objp;
- %{
- % char *ptr;
- % int size;
- %
- % ptr = objp->ut_line;
- % size = sizeof(objp->ut_line);
- % if (!xdr_bytes(xdrs, &ptr, &size, size)) {
- % return (FALSE);
- % }
- % ptr = objp->ut_name;
- % size = sizeof(objp->ut_line);
- % if (!xdr_bytes(xdrs, &ptr, &size, size)) {
- % return (FALSE);
- % }
- % ptr = objp->ut_host;
- % size = sizeof(objp->ut_host);
- % if (!xdr_bytes(xdrs, &ptr, &size, size)) {
- % return (FALSE);
- % }
- % if (!xdr_long(xdrs, &objp->ut_time)) {
- % return (FALSE);
- % }
- % return (TRUE);
- %}
- %
- %bool_t
- %xdr_utmpptr(xdrs, objpp)
- % XDR *xdrs;
- % struct utmp **objpp;
- %{
- % if (!xdr_reference(xdrs, (char **) objpp, sizeof (struct ru_utmp),
- % xdr_utmp)) {
- % return (FALSE);
- % }
- % return (TRUE);
- %}
- %
- %bool_t
- %xdr_utmparr(xdrs, objp)
- % XDR *xdrs;
- % struct utmparr *objp;
- %{
- % if (!xdr_array(xdrs, (char **)&objp->uta_arr, (u_int *)&objp->uta_cnt,
- % MAXUSERS, sizeof(struct utmp *), xdr_utmpptr)) {
- % return (FALSE);
- % }
- % return (TRUE);
- %}
- %
- %bool_t
- %xdr_utmpidle(xdrs, objp)
- % XDR *xdrs;
- % struct utmpidle *objp;
- %{
- % if (!xdr_utmp(xdrs, &objp->ui_utmp)) {
- % return (FALSE);
- % }
- % if (!xdr_u_int(xdrs, &objp->ui_idle)) {
- % return (FALSE);
- % }
- % return (TRUE);
- %}
- %
- %bool_t
- %xdr_utmpidleptr(xdrs, objpp)
- % XDR *xdrs;
- % struct utmpidle **objpp;
- %{
- % if (!xdr_reference(xdrs, (char **) objpp, sizeof (struct utmpidle),
- % xdr_utmpidle)) {
- % return (FALSE);
- % }
- % return (TRUE);
- %}
- %
- %bool_t
- %xdr_utmpidlearr(xdrs, objp)
- % XDR *xdrs;
- % struct utmpidlearr *objp;
- %{
- % if (!xdr_array(xdrs, (char **)&objp->uia_arr, (u_int *)&objp->uia_cnt,
- % MAXUSERS, sizeof(struct utmpidle *), xdr_utmpidleptr)) {
- % return (FALSE);
- % }
- % return (TRUE);
- %}
- #endif
